December 16, 20169 yr I just installed and ran the Fix Common Problems utility and it is saying that my var/log is at 100% and that this is unusual, my server has been on for 38 days, any ideas what could be causing this, I have attached the diagnostics. wedge_server-diagnostics-20161215-1837.zip
December 16, 20169 yr Please post the output from running the following commands via an ssh session: df -h /var/log du -sm /var/log/*
December 16, 20169 yr It's a docker related issue. docker.log is filling up your /var/log -rw-rw-rw- 1 root root 131870720 Dec 6 15:21 docker.log.1
December 16, 20169 yr It's a docker related issue. docker.log is filling up your /var/log -rw-rw-rw- 1 root root 131870720 Dec 6 15:21 docker.log.1 Which means that there's a recurring issue happening that docker keeps complaining about. Reboot the system to fix the /var/log problem, let the system run for a couple of days, then post your diagnostics again.
